This post looks into the types of BMW keys, the replacement procedure, options for obtaining a new key, and answers regularly asked concerns.Kinds Of BMW KeysBMW car keys have actually evolved considerably throughout the years. With developments in innovation, their keys now feature numerous functions. Below is an introduction of the various kinds of BMW keys.Standard KeyDescription: A fundamental, metal key that runs the lorry's locks and ignition.Compatibility: Older BMW designs.Remote Key FobDescription: A key with integrated remote locking, unlocking functions, and often a panic button.Compatibility: Many mid-range BMW designs constructed from the late 1990s onwards.Smart KeyDescription: An advanced key that offers keyless entry and allows you to begin the car with the push of a button.Compatibility: Most more recent BMW designs.Key CardDescription: A slim card that can be used in location of a conventional key, usually connected with high-end designs.Compatibility: Selected high-end BMW models.To show the key types, refer to the table below:Key TypeFeaturesCompatibilityTraditional KeyMetal constructionOlder modelsRemote Key FobRemote locking/unlockingLate 1990s and more recentSmart KeyKeyless entry, push-start engineA lot of more recent modelsKey CardSlim card alternativeHigh-end modelsThe BMW Key Replacement ProcessReplacing a BMW key might seem daunting, but following structured steps can simplify the process. Here's how you can set about getting a replacement key:Step-by-Step GuideIdentify the Key Type: Determine the kind of key you require for your specific model.Gather Required Information: Collect needed documents such as:Vehicle Identification Number (VIN)Proof of ownership (title, registration, or proof of purchase)A government-issued IDPick Replacement Options:Authorized BMW Dealership Qualified LocksmithAftermarket Key ProvidersGo To the Chosen Option: Depending on your option, check out an authorized dealership or call a licensed locksmith.Configuring the Key: New keys usually require programming. This can just be done with customized devices, which most dealerships and certified locksmith professionals possess.Get Your New Key: After programming, you will receive your new key. Make certain to evaluate its functionality before leaving the premises.Aspects Affecting Replacement CostsKey Type: Smart keys usually cost more to replace than conventional keys.Programming Fees: Some providers charge extra fees for key programming.Area: Costs may vary based upon local rates and accessibility of services.Replacement OptionAverage CostKey Programming CostLicensed BMW Dealership₤ 200 - ₤ 500₤ 50 - ₤ 100Qualified Locksmith₤ 100 - ₤ 350₤ 30 - ₤ 70Aftermarket Key Providers₤ 80 - ₤ 300DiffersOften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How long does it require to replace a BMW key?The procedure can take anywhere from a few hours to a number of days, depending on the supplier and the availability of parts.2. Can I replace my BMW key myself?Usually, the programs requires specialized tools that are not offered to the average customer. It is suggested to consult a professional.3. What if I have lost all my keys?You will need to check out an authorized dealership or qualified locksmith with evidence of ownership to get your automobile's locks rekeyed and a new key made.4. Is it worth getting an aftermarket key?Aftermarket keys can be less expensive but typically lack the same performance as original keys.
